‘I Am Sam Kinison’ Airs on Spike TV Next Month

A new documentary exploring the life and career of Sam Kinison debuts on Spike TV next month, and today the network released the trailer. Here’s the Trailer for Craig Ferguson’s Netflix Standup Special ‘Tickle Fight’

Craig Ferguson heads to Netflix next month with a brand new standup special, and today the streaming network released the trailer. Titled Tickle Fight, the special follows Ferguson as he discusses “’70s porn, Japanese toilets and his mildly crime-filled days as a talk show host,” and it makes its Netflix debut next Tuesday, December 5th. Dave Chappelle’s Third Netflix Special ‘Equanimity’ Debuts on New Year’s Eve

Netflix is closing out 2017 with the final standup special of the three-special deal it made with Dave Chappelle last year. Following The Age of Spin and Deep in the Heart of Texas earlier this year, the streaming network announced today that the third special, titled Equanimity, will debut on New Year’s Eve next month. Comedy Central Announces Its Next Round of Half-Hour Standup Specials

Comedy Central just announced the next batch of half-hour standup specials as part of its series Comedy Central Stand-Up Presents. Like the last round of specials, the series will tape at The Civic Theatre in New Orleans.
